正文:
深度神经网络在计算机视觉、自然语言处理等复杂任务中的表现,往往因训练过程的复杂性而面临诸多挑战。优化深度神经网络的核心目标——在有限的计算资源下实现高精度、快速收敛的训练,已成为人工智能研究中的核心问题。然而,传统深度学习模型在优化过程中所面临的瓶颈,往往成为制约其广泛应用的关键制约因素。
首先,训练时间与计算资源的消耗是普遍存在的问题。深度神经网络的反向传播过程通常会陷入局部极小值,导致训练时间变长,并且网络参数的更新速度难以控制。例如,在卷积神经网络(CNN)中,梯度消失现象可能导致训练过早收敛,无法有效捕捉数据中的局部模式。为应对这一问题,研究者常采用梯度衰减策略,在反向传播过程中逐步减少梯度的衰减率,从而避免模型过拟合。此外,优化算法的选择也需结合任务需求,如使用Adam优化器或自适应方法进行动态调整。
其次,模型参数爆炸问题是另一重要挑战。随着神经网络层数和参数数量的增加,参数数量呈指数增长,导致训练过程中计算资源消耗迅速。例如,在深度学习中,每层的参数数通常达到上百万级别,若训练过程中参数更新率过快,可能导致模型参数逐渐爆炸,无法有效学习输入数据的深层特征。为缓解这一问题,研究者尝试引入量化技术或分布式计算,以减少计算复杂度。此外,优化算法的参数更新策略,如使用分层策略或自适应步长,也能够有效降低参数爆炸的影响。
此外,过拟合与欠拟合是另一类常见的优化问题。在训练过程中,模型可能因过度拟合训练数据而导致泛化能力下降,或者因欠拟合无法捕捉数据的复杂结构。为应对过拟合,研究者常引入交叉验证、正则化方法以及集成学习等方式,以增强模型的泛化能力。同时,优化算法的参数选择,如使用交叉验证划分训练集,或采用L1正则化等约束项,也能够帮助模型避免过拟合,提升泛化能力。
在实际应用中,优化深度神经网络的难点还可能与数据规模和实时处理能力有关。例如,在大规模数据集的训练过程中,模型训练时间可能超出计算资源的承受范围,而实时处理任务则需要优化算法的效率。为应对这一问题,研究者尝试在优化过程中引入动态调整机制,如根据训练进度调整参数更新策略,或引入硬件加速技术,以提升计算效率。
综上所述,深度神经网络优化的难点在于训练时间、计算资源消耗、参数爆炸问题、过拟合与欠拟合,以及数据规模与实时处理能力。然而,通过优化算法、量化技术、动态调整机制以及分布式计算等手段,研究人员仍能有效克服这些问题,推动深度神经网络的广泛应用。未来,随着计算能力的提升和优化算法的改进,深度神经网络的优化将更加高效,成为人工智能发展的关键驱动力。
本文由AI大模型(qwen3:0.6b)结合行业知识与创新视角深度思考后创作。